  3. My unRAID server just keeps randomly freezing up and rebooting. It started off happening 1 time. I just figured it was a power flicker and/or the UPS wigged out. Rebooted it and it was fine. About 3 weeks later I woke up to notice Plex wasn't responding so I tried to login and it had froze. Rebooted and it was fine. About 1 week later and it did it again. Now it's every 30 minutes to 1 hour. It'll come up and be fine every time with no clues as to what errors might be causing it. I haven't made any changes recently. The only error I get is a Machine Check that tells me my CPU (Ryzen 5800x) isn't supported and I need to download a different plugin? But when I look into it, I've seen my version of unRAID (latest stable) it is supported and that error really doesn't mean anything. Also I've been getting that error since I installed this over a year ago and it hasn't been a problem. Things I've tried: Exporting Syslogs to my desktop -No clues Stopping all Dockers and VM's -With all Dockers and VM's stopped it stayed on long enough for me to backup my dockers to my desktop but otherwise will froze and rebooted after about 1.5 hours. Safemode -Still freezes Disabled XMP Profile -No change Checked SSD scrubbing and balancing -No change I've exported my diags below. Maybe someone here smarter than me can make sense of what might be going on. I'm currently running a memtest but it's now 5am and I can't keep going. Gonna let it run till it's finished.
